.show__all:hover span[data-v-12a5013e],.show__all:hover span[data-v-629266e3]{transform:translate(10px)}.card_index[data-v-fb7cc464]{transition:all .3s ease-in-out}.card_article:hover .card_index[data-v-fb7cc464]{color:var(--ui-text-inverted);scale:1.02}@media(hover:none){.card_index[data-v-fb7cc464]{color:var(--ui-text-inverted)}}.map svg{height:auto;width:100%}.map svg circle,.map svg path{cursor:pointer;stroke:#fff3;stroke-width:1;transition:all .3s cubic-bezier(.4,0,.2,1);z-index:10}.map svg circle:hover,.map svg path:hover{stroke:var(--ui-accent);stroke-width:2;z-index:20}.map svg circle:hover{fill:var(--ui-primary)}.active__district,.map svg circle:active,.map svg path:active{stroke:var(--ui-accent)!important;stroke-dasharray:none;stroke-width:3!important;z-index:30}.map svg circle:active{fill:var(--ui-primary)}.poi-counter{pointer-events: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}.city-stroke{fill:none;stroke:#fff;stroke-miterlimit:10}.city,.city-stroke{transition:all .4s ease}.city{fill:#fff}.district-tooltip{background:var(--ui-accent);border-radius:10px;box-shadow:0 10px 22px #00000040;color:#fff;font-size:13px;line-height:1.2;padding:8px 10px;pointer-events:none;position:fixed;-webkit-user-select:none;-moz-user-select:none;user-select:none;white-space:nowrap;z-index:9999}.map__badges[data-v-fe6aa2b9]{box-shadow:0 2px 2px #e9e1d1}.show__all:hover span[data-v-fe6aa2b9],.show__all:hover span[data-v-769d8987]{transform:translate(10px)}
